San Felippo just misses cycle in pair of wins against Fairmont State

Firelands graduate Dominic San Felippo hit a home run, a triple and a double, just missing the cycle by a single, as the Wheeling Jesuit baseball team opened WVIAC play with a two-game sweep of Fairmont State University. The Cardinals claimed the day game by a score of 6-4 and pounded out 11 hits in the nightcap for a 10-3 victory.

San Felippo drove in two RBIs with a single and a solo homerun. He now has three home runs on the season, along with 13RBIs in 11 games started. His batting average is .308. He also has five stolen bases.

San Felippo notches NCBWA All-Atlantic Region Second Team honors


Firelands’ Dominic San Felippo earned Atlantic Region Second Team honors for his outstanding season playing baseball at Wheeling Jesuit.

San Felippo, a junior outfielder, finished the season with a .446 batting average (62-for-139). San Felippo had 21 extra-base hits, which include 15 doubles, a triple and five home runs. He also had 35 RBIs and scored 35 runs.

San Felippo off to strong start for Wheeling Jesuit




Firelands’ Dominic San Felippo went 7-for-9 for Wheeling Jesuit University in a double header played in Pennsylvania last weekend. He had four doubles and five RBIs to help lead Jesuit to a doubleheader sweep with scores of 9-4 and 14-0.

Sullivan named WVIAC Pitcher of the Week



Avon native Shane Sullivan was named the West Virginia Intercollegiate Athletic Conference Pitcher of the Week for his performance last week pitching for Wheeling Jesuit University.

Sullivan, a freshman who graduated from Holy Name, earned a pair of wins and a save during four relief appearances. He allowed just four hits and two earned runs in 8 1/3 innings of work to earn victories against Saginaw Valley State and Charleston. He struck out five batters and didn’t yield a walk.

San Felippo brothers reunite on baseball diamond in college









WEST LIBERTY, West Virginia
- Brothers Tony San Felippo and Dominic San Felippo had a chance to reunite on the baseball field last week.

Tony’s West Liberty State College Hilltoppers celebrated Senior Day by sweeping Dominic’s Wheeling Jesuit College Cardinals, 10-2 and 13-3 in a double header played at Kovalik Field in West Virginia.

Tony was acknowleged before the game with fellow seniors, while brother Dominic had a good seat from the opposing dugout to see his brother’s four-year career get honored.

Tony is currently batting .271 (13-for-48) with eight RBIs in 19 games played.

As a junior, Tony started in 36 of 38 games at shortstop. He hit .254 with six RBIs and 26 runs scored.

As a sophomore, he started in all 49 games at shortstop and batted .307 with a team-best 42 hits. He added 20 RBIs and scored 27 runs.

Dominic, who is a sophomore, has started 37 games and leads the Cardinals with a .357 batting average. He has four doubles, a triple and third-best on the team with 14 RBIs.

The brothers played together for two years at Firelands High School and have a younger brother Joe, an eighth grader that will play high school baseball next year.
